News

The biggest stories of the day delivered to your inbox.
The biggest stories of the day delivered to your inbox.
Marvel had originally planned an "Inhumans" movie to hit theaters in 2019, but changed those plans and made it a TV show. The show will premiere in IMAX theaters and then be broadcast on ABC.